We are presently travelling around Australia & drove from Brisbane with an old camper modified from a 6x4 box trailer with a OzTrail 6 camper setup. This was a good setup and served it's purpose.

We always thought we would upgrade sometime, however after spending some time in Adelaide, we traded up and purchased a Liberty On Road Camper Trailer. This gave us more packing room with 550 mm sides, extended drawbar, swinging tailgate, three jerry can holders, two gas cylinder holders & a spare wheel on the drawbar.

The arrangement also gave us more sleeping & living space. The camper came with an enclosed annexe & floor. We also opted for the Drifta swingout kitchen unit which we just love or should I say, my wife just loves. We are very pleased with the camper & have to be as we intend to spend some time on the road.
